Drought Rates by Conference
Conferences differ in drought rate by more than fans assume. The high-major leagues (ACC, Big 12, Big Ten, SEC) cluster low: their offenses are stable enough that 3-minute cold stretches are rare. The mid-majors (MWC, A-10, AAC) span a wider range, with top programs running at high-major rates and bottom programs leaking points. The low-majors are where droughts compound — weaker offenses go cold more often, weaker defenses fail to capitalize on opponents' droughts, and the results swing wider as a consequence.

Why it matters at tournament time. Selection-committee bubble teams from the mid-major tier almost always have a worse drought profile than the at-large field — and that gap predicts March performance better than KenPom efficiency margin alone. Drought rate is a stand-in for offensive stability, and offensive stability is what survives a single-elimination format.
